Prostaglandin analogues: final Opinion of the SCCS
In its assessment in early 2022, the SCCS was unable to reach a conclusion on the safety of prostaglandin analogues substances. The industry has since provided new data, and the Scientific Committee has re-evaluated these substances and has just published the final version of its new Opinion.
Basic Blue 99, Basic Brown 16: final versions of the SCCS Scientific Advices
In March, the SCCS (Scientific Committee on Consumer Safety) accepted mandates from the European Commission to assess the safety of two hair dye ingredients, Basic blue 99 (C059) and Basic Brown 16 (C009). It just published the final versions of its Scientific Advices.
Thiomersal, Phenylmercuric salts: final Opinion of the SCCS
In January 2025, the SCCS accepted the European Commission’s mandate to assess the safety of Thiomersal and Phenylmercury salts as preservatives. The Scientific Committee on Consumer Safety has just published the final Opinion of its Scientific Advice.
Aggregate exposure to salicylic acid: Request for Opinion to the SCCS
On January 12, 2026, the Scientific Committee on Consumer Safety (SCCS) approved, by written procedure, the European Commission’s mandate to assess the safety of aggregate exposure to salicylic acid and its esters. The Scientific Committee has 12 months to deliver its opinion.
Micron-sized Silver : preliminary Opinion of the SCCS
In October 2025, the SCCS accepted the European Commission’s mandate to evaluate the safety of micron-sized particulate Silver in cosmetic products. The Scientific Committee on Consumer Safety has just published its preliminary Opinion. It is open for comments until February 23, 2026.
